I’m a person-centred counsellor who believes that being real sits at the heart of meaningful change – not just in therapy, but in life.

I retrained as a counsellor at 35, which means I truly live by the belief that it’s never too late to change direction or start again. Self-awareness has been a lifelong practice for me, and I know first-hand what it feels like to sit in the client’s chair. That experience shapes how I work: with empathy, openness, and deep respect for your story.

I’m a single mum of two daughters and was diagnosed later in life with ADHD and PMDD, which has deepened my understanding of how complex, nuanced, and individual our inner worlds can be. It’s another reason I work in a way that centres you – your pace, your needs, your reality.

At the centre of my practice is the belief that when you’re met with honesty, compassion and acceptance, real change becomes possible.
